We’re partnering with a growing, design-led interior studio looking for a Project Manager to take ownership of projects from concept through to installation. You’ll be the person who keeps everything moving, coordinating designers, clients, contractors and suppliers to deliver exceptional spaces on time and on budget.

What you’ll be doing:

  • Managing interior design projects from brief to final install.
  • Acting as the main client contact throughout the project.
  • Coordinating designers, contractors, and suppliers.
  • Managing budgets, procurement, and timelines.
  • Conducting site visits and ensuring projects run smoothly.

What they’re looking for:

  • 3–5+ years’ project management experience in interiors, architecture or construction.
  • Strong organisational skills and client communication.
  • Experience managing multiple projects and stakeholders.
  • Knowledge of design processes, materials and furnishings.
